Taxonomic Classification

Rank Hispaniolan Green Treefrog Lesser Yellow-shouldered Bat
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Amphibia (Amphibians)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Anura (Frogs & Toads) Chiroptera (Bats)
Family Hylidae Phyllostomidae
Genus Boana Sturnira
Species Boana heilprini Sturnira nana

Evolutionary Relationship

Hispaniolan Green Treefrog and Lesser Yellow-shouldered Bat share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
